My name is Kevin Zheng Lu, although many of my friends call me KLU, a nickname that caught on in high school. I grew up on the outskirts of Dallas in an immigrant Buddhist household, where from a young age I became fascinated by our complex relationship with nature and humanity. Although money was hard to come by, my family was rich in different aspects: hand-picked garden produce, potluck community dinners, and stand-by flights that took us around the world.
I knew that I wanted to one day go beyond my small town to explore how to create transformative impact on the lives we lead and the land we live on. This guided me to Los Angeles, where I graduated from USC Annenberg as a Brittingham Social Enterprise Lab Scholar and focused on how we can design media and technology for social innovation. Since then, I’ve led brand and storytelling across startups, nonprofits, and venture capital for organizations like Alltruists (YC W21) and Designer Fund. I’ve also built communities for student entrepreneurs and launched programs for young global leaders. Most recently, I worked on content design for climate tech software at Salesforce.
Now, I’m focused on harnessing nature to scale climate action and tackle one of the most pressing issues of our time. Some other things I’m currently thinking about:
Inspiring more compassionate, high-humanity individuals to align their talents with their intention and purpose
The art of storytelling and resonant writing cultures that cultivate taste, identity, and unity
Shifting design from being human-centered to becoming nature-centered, where ecology and technology can work in harmony
Community spaces of gathering that revolve around thematic aesthetics, goals, and culinary profiles
The value of spirituality in how we understand our past, present, and future selves
I’m currently based in Tallinn as a Fulbright Scholar at the Tallinn University of Technology, where I’m researching strategic futures for Estonian climate entrepreneurs and support mechanisms for high-impact deep technologies.
